Our contracts are fair and straightforward – 12 weeks to begin with, followed by a rolling contract with just a 14-day notice period. We don’t believe in tying people in for 20 weeks or asking for long 4 week notice terms. We want you to stay with us because you’re happy with the service we’re providing, not because the paperwork says you have to.

The main requirement is an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C), which is valid for 10 years. If you don’t have a current one, we can help arrange this for you.
